She's former Connecticut Secretary of State, Democrat Susan Bysiewicz. I frankly don't know much about her, but she has won statewide races before and will be formidable.
Her candidacy announcement signals that she'll focus on Lieberman's attention deficit with respect to his home state.
As reported in the New Haven Register:
In a statement released earlier, Bysiewicz said, “We need a senator who is 100 percent focused on helping our state, and Senator Joe Lieberman has been focused on everything but Connecticut. I will only work for the people of Connecticut so we can create jobs that keep our children and grandchildren here in Connecticut for generations to come.”
As for the Senator himself, The Register reports that he has made a decision whether to run for re-election and will announce it tomorrow at a press conference in Stamford:
“After many thoughtful conversations with family and friends over the last several months, Senator Lieberman made a decision about his future over the holidays which he plans to announce on Wednesday," said Lieberman press secretary Erika Masonhall in an e-mail to the Register.
